  After I try hello.light plate I've tried with hello.temp plate to receive and display the temperature. I had 
  already downloaded the Tkinter module, and serial numpy.
  I've used Ubuntu gedit to open the file hello.temp.45.py and I made the following changes 
  (hello.temp.45.prueba.py):
  •
  I've changed the canvas size
  •
  I have also changed the color of the canvas.
  •
  I've added text. I have also changed the position and size of the text displayed temperature.
  •
  I have changed the title of the window and the character to close the window.
  •
  To show the temperature increase I have used a rectangle which grows in proportion to the 
  temperature rise.
